Measuring the Operating Time of the Circuit Breaker (only 7SJ64)

Only for Synchronism Check
If device 7SJ64 is equipped with the function for synchronism and voltage check and it is applied, it is necessary
– under asynchronous system conditions – that the operating time of the circuit breaker is measured and set
correctly when closing. If the synchronism check function is not used or only for closing under synchronous
system conditions, this subsection is irrelevant.
For measuring the operating time a setup as shown in Figure 3-39 is recommended. The timer is set to a range
of 1 s and a graduation of 1 ms.
The circuit breaker is connected manually. At the same time the timer is started. After closing the poles of the

If the timer is not stopped due to an unfavourable closing moment, the attempt will be repeated.
It is particularly favourable to calculate the mean value from several (3 to 5) successful switching attempts.
In address 6X20 set this time to T-CB close (under Power System Data of the synchronism check). Select
the next lower settable value.
